package com.coremedia.iso.boxes;
import com.coremedia.iso.IsoTypeReader;
import com.coremedia.iso.IsoTypeWriter;
import com.googlecode.mp4parser.AbstractFullBox;
import java.nio.ByteBuffer;
/**
* <code>
* Box Type: 'mvhd'<br>
* Container: {@link MovieBox} ('moov')<br>
* Mandatory: Yes<br>
* Quantity: Exactly one<br><br>
* </code>
* This box defines overall information which is media-independent, and relevant to the entire presentation
* considered as a whole.
*/
public class MovieHeaderBox extends AbstractFullBox {
private long creationTime;
private long modificationTime;
private long timescale;
private long duration;
private double rate = 1.0;
private float volume = 1.0f;
private long[] matrix = new long[]{0x00010000, 0, 0, 0, 0x00010000, 0, 0, 0, 0x40000000};
private long nextTrackId;
private int previewTime;
private int previewDuration;
private int posterTime;
private int selectionTime;
private int selectionDuration;
private int currentTime;
public static final String TYPE = "mvhd";
public MovieHeaderBox() {
super(TYPE);
}
public long getCreationTime() {
return creationTime;
}
public long getModificationTime() {
return modificationTime;
}
public long getTimescale() {
return timescale;
}
public long getDuration() {
return duration;
}
public double getRate() {
return rate;
}
public float getVolume() {
return volume;
}
public long[] getMatrix() {
return matrix;
}
public long getNextTrackId() {
return nextTrackId;
}
protected long getContentSize() {
long contentSize = 4;
if (getVersion() == 1) {
contentSize += 28;
} else {
contentSize += 16;
}
contentSize += 80;
return contentSize;
}
@Override
public void _parseDetails(ByteBuffer content) {
parseVersionAndFlags(content);
if (getVersion() == 1) {
creationTime = IsoTypeReader.readUInt64(content);
modificationTime = IsoTypeReader.readUInt64(content);
timescale = IsoTypeReader.readUInt32(content);
duration = IsoTypeReader.readUInt64(content);
} else {
creationTime = IsoTypeReader.readUInt32(content);
modificationTime = IsoTypeReader.readUInt32(content);
timescale = IsoTypeReader.readUInt32(content);
duration = IsoTypeReader.readUInt32(content);
}
rate = IsoTypeReader.readFixedPoint1616(content);
volume = IsoTypeReader.readFixedPoint88(content);
IsoTypeReader.readUInt16(content);
IsoTypeReader.readUInt32(content);
IsoTypeReader.readUInt32(content);
matrix = new long[9];
for (int i = 0; i < 9; i++) {
matrix[i] = IsoTypeReader.readUInt32(content);
}
previewTime = content.getInt();
previewDuration = content.getInt();
posterTime = content.getInt();
selectionTime = content.getInt();
selectionDuration = content.getInt();
currentTime = content.getInt();
nextTrackId = IsoTypeReader.readUInt32(content);
}
public String toString() {
StringBuilder result = new StringBuilder();
result.append("MovieHeaderBox[");
result.append("creationTime=").append(getCreationTime());
result.append(";");
result.append("modificationTime=").append(getModificationTime());
result.append(";");
result.append("timescale=").append(getTimescale());
result.append(";");
result.append("duration=").append(getDuration());
result.append(";");
result.append("rate=").append(getRate());
result.append(";");
result.append("volume=").append(getVolume());
for (int i = 0; i < matrix.length; i++) {
result.append(";");
result.append("matrix").append(i).append("=").append(matrix[i]);
}
result.append(";");
result.append("nextTrackId=").append(getNextTrackId());
result.append("]");
return result.toString();
}
@Override
protected void getContent(ByteBuffer byteBuffer) {
writeVersionAndFlags(byteBuffer);
if (getVersion() == 1) {
IsoTypeWriter.writeUInt64(byteBuffer, creationTime);
IsoTypeWriter.writeUInt64(byteBuffer, modificationTime);
IsoTypeWriter.writeUInt32(byteBuffer, timescale);
IsoTypeWriter.writeUInt64(byteBuffer, duration);
} else {
IsoTypeWriter.writeUInt32(byteBuffer, creationTime);
IsoTypeWriter.writeUInt32(byteBuffer, modificationTime);
IsoTypeWriter.writeUInt32(byteBuffer, timescale);
IsoTypeWriter.writeUInt32(byteBuffer, duration);
}
IsoTypeWriter.writeFixedPont1616(byteBuffer, rate);
IsoTypeWriter.writeFixedPont88(byteBuffer, volume);
IsoTypeWriter.writeUInt16(byteBuffer, 0);
IsoTypeWriter.writeUInt32(byteBuffer, 0);
IsoTypeWriter.writeUInt32(byteBuffer, 0);
for (int i = 0; i < 9; i++) {
IsoTypeWriter.writeUInt32(byteBuffer, matrix[i]);
}
byteBuffer.putInt(previewTime);
byteBuffer.putInt(previewDuration);
byteBuffer.putInt(posterTime);
byteBuffer.putInt(selectionTime);
byteBuffer.putInt(selectionDuration);
byteBuffer.putInt(currentTime);
IsoTypeWriter.writeUInt32(byteBuffer, nextTrackId);
}
